Port Strike Suspended with Tentative Agreement in Place

Three days after port workers walked off the job, a tentative agreement is in place that extends the current contract through January 15, 2025.

154: How Pocatello Electric Became a Community Staple

154: How Pocatello Electric Became a Community Staple

For over 120 years, Pocatello Electric has served the many needs of its local residents in southeast Idaho. That longevity has helped them become the oldest family-owned appliance store in the country. We chat with current-day owner Suzie Vigliaturo about business, what’s worked and how they’ve evolved over the years to remain relevant with their customers.

153: An Inflation Reduction Act Deep Dive with Frank Sandtner

153: An Inflation Reduction Act Deep Dive with Frank Sandtner

Passed in August 2022, the Inflation Reduction Act is considered a landmark piece of legislation that will have a major impact on many industries for decades to come — including retail. The energy efficiency portion of the bill aims to provide consumers with various tax credits and other yet-to-be-determined benefits pending state-level programs that will roll out in relation to this bill. There’s a ton to unpack, but we attempt to do just that with Nationwide Marketing Group’s Director of Business Services Frank Sandtner.
